How Mobile Tire Repair Works
An efficient mobile tire repair process can substantially increase the convenience for drivers facing unexpected issues. Initially, drivers contact a mobile tire repair service, supplying details about their location and the nature of the tire problem. Upon receiving the request, the service dispatches a qualified technician equipped with the required tools and replacement parts.
When they arrive, the technician inspects the situation, diagnosing the issue—be it a flat tire, puncture, or damage. After assessing the tire's condition, the technician moves forward with the repair or replacement. If the tire is repairable, they will apply a patch or plug, ensuring a proper seal. In cases where the tire is beyond repair, a replacement is installed using the appropriate tire size and type.
Upon completing the repair, the technician performs a safety check to confirm everything is operating as intended before finalizing the service, permitting the driver to resume their journey with confidence.

Kind of Tire Harm
The type of tire damage significantly affects the pricing of mobile tire repair services. Various forms of damage, including punctures, sidewall tears, or tread separation, range in intricacy and demanded technical knowledge. Punctures, for instance, are often simpler to fix and may incur lower costs, while sidewall damage typically requires tire replacement, causing greater financial outlay. Furthermore, the severity of the damage plays an essential role; small problems can often be addressed swiftly and economically, whereas extensive damage could require expert instruments and increased effort. Ultimately, the type of tire damage directly impacts not only the repair method but also the overall cost of the service, making it a critical element for customers seeking mobile tire repair solutions.

Tips for Maintaining Your Tires From One to Another Repairs
To ensure peak performance and longevity of tires, regular maintenance is essential between repairs. Drivers should regularly check tire pressure, as insufficiently inflated tires can cause uneven wear and reduced fuel efficiency. Maintaining the correct pressure not only enhances performance but also extends tire life. Moreover, regular visual inspections for signs of wear, such as cracks or bulges, can stop potential issues before they escalate.
Regular tire rotation every 5,000 to 7,000 miles provides even wear across all tires, resulting in balanced handling and extended durability. Additionally, keeping tires clean from debris and road grime aids in sustaining their integrity. It is also wise to monitor tread depth; using the penny test can identify whether tires need replacement. Lastly, proper alignment and balancing can reduce wear and enhance ride comfort, providing a safer driving experience. Regular attention to these factors can significantly impact tire longevity and performance.
